A/C unit and heater not working

Hello,
I have a 2022 Montana 3761FL with the Legacy Package. We went on a short trip only to find out we could not get the A/C unit in the front or rear to power on. I have tried all different temp settings on the in command system and nothing seems to work, not even just the fan. Any suggestions?

Try taking all power off your rig including fully disconnecting the battery. That will reset your in command and may fix the issue.
